20 schools in Alabama offer welding-related programs, compared below on official cost, completion, and earnings data. Federal program data groups welding with machining & cnc — schools below may offer any of these.
Occupation pay is what working welding professionals in Alabama earn (all experience levels) — school "earnings" figures above are medians for each school's recent federally-aided students across all its programs, which read lower.
| School | City | Type | Net price / yr | Completion | Earnings (10 yr)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| George C Wallace Community College-Dothan | Dothan | public | $1,170 | 36.5% | $31,399 |
| Reid State Technical College | Evergreen | public | $1,739 | 50.3% | $28,982 |
| Northeast Alabama Community College | Rainsville | public | $2,756 | 46.3% | $34,913 |
| Northwest Shoals Community College | Muscle Shoals | public | $2,838 | 37.2% | $33,828 |
| Lurleen B Wallace Community College | Andalusia | public | $2,792 | 42.5% | $32,307 |
| Gadsden State Community College | Gadsden | public | $3,515 | 31.2% | $32,937 |
| Southern Union State Community College | Wadley | public | $6,142 | 30.3% | $36,597 |
| Bevill State Community College | Jasper | public | $5,937 | 35.9% | $34,107 |
| Bishop State Community College | Mobile | public | $5,397 | 28% | $29,916 |
| Lawson State Community College | Birmingham | public | $6,275 | 24% | $31,701 |
| John C Calhoun State Community College | Tanner | public | $7,660 | 29.9% | $38,192 |
| J. F. Drake State Community and Technical College | Huntsville | public | $6,005 | 20.7% | $28,281 |
| H Councill Trenholm State Community College | Montgomery | public | $8,325 | 39.5% | $32,183 |
| George C Wallace State Community College-Selma | Selma | public | $9,272 | 30.4% | $31,598 |
| George C Wallace State Community College-Hanceville | Hanceville | public | $13,170 | 44.4% | $39,842 |
| Coastal Alabama Community College | Bay Minette | public | $13,644 | 24.1% | $34,894 |
| Shelton State Community College | Tuscaloosa | public | $14,557 | 22% | $35,014 |
| Central Alabama Community College | Alexander City | public | $15,996 | 27.6% | $33,506 |
| Fortis Institute-Birmingham | Birmingham | private for-profit | $25,946 | 53.3% | $32,886 |
| J F Ingram State Technical College | Deatsville | public | not reported | 17.5% | not reported |
Ranking = median earnings 10 years after entry per $1,000 of average yearly net price (methodology). Figures are institution-wide federal medians for each school as a whole — not welding graduates specifically. Schools without both figures sort last — "not reported" means the federal dataset lacks the value, not that the school is bad.
